HTML-szerkesztés kezdőknek!!!
  • Dj Faustus #6868
    "Na szval van egy css fájl. És van benne több <div>."
    A CSS-ben nincs <div> tag. Az a HTML-ben van. ;)

    Komolyra véve a szót:
    "Az lenn a kérdésem, hogy több <div>-et hogy tudok egymás mellé berakni?"
    A kulcsszó: lebegtetés, azaz float.

    Tehát ha ilyen a HTML struktúrád:
    <div>aaa</div>
    <div>bbb</div>
    <div>ccc</div>


    Akkor hogy egymás mellé kerüljenek:
    div {float: left;}

    Ha nem akarsz minden <div> elemet egymás mellé rakni, csak bizonyosakat, használj azonosítót, vagy osztályt, illetve használd a clear tulajdonságot - ami megszünteti a float hatását:
    <div id="menu">
    <ul>
    <li><a href="#">aaa</a></li>
    <li><a href="#">bbb</a></li>
    <li><a href="#">ccc</a></li>
    </ul>
    </div>
    <div id="content">
    Blabla
    </div>
    <div id="clearer"></div>
    <div id="nemlebeg">No floating</div>


    #menu, #content {
    float: left;
    }
    #clearer {
    clear: both;
    }


    Osztállyal:
    <div class="kep">
    <img src="kep1.jpg" alt="kep1" />
    </div>
    <div class="kep">
    <img src="kep2.jpg" alt="kep2" />
    </div>
    <div class="kep">
    <img src="kep3.jpg" alt="kep3" />
    </div>
    <div class="kep">
    <img src="kep4.jpg" alt="kep4" />
    </div>
    <div id="clearer"></div>
    <div id="nemlebeg">No floating</div>


    .kep {
    float: left;
    }
    #clearer {
    clear: both;
    }